2006
With the introduction of Vivid e, GE expanded the reach of echo by bringing compact ultrasound into the physician's office. 4D real time color flow and AFI (Automated Function Imaging) came to Vivid 7 and 4D LV volume measurement became available on EchoPAC.

For the first time since 2004, GE introduced a new concept and performance level for its cardiovascular ultrasound consoles. By leveraging the miniaturization expertise gained from the compact Vivid i, the performance expertise of the console Vivid 7 and the proven utility and versatility of the Vivid 4, GE broadened its portfolio with a new "signature class" of ultrasound. The Vivid S6 and S5 signature class cardiovascular ultrasound systems hit the market, delivering strong performance, excellent image quality and innovative design. Ultra-Definition Imaging arrived as an all-new feature on the Vivid 7, combining image acquisition and processing technology, allowing for optimal images with one-button control.
